Best Quotes about Knowledge

1.
Try to put well in practice what you already know. In so doing, you will, in good time, discover the hidden things you now inquire about.
Rembrandt (Harmenszoon van Rijn)

2.
To succeed in business, to reach the top, an individual must know all it is possible to know about that business.
Getty, J. Paul

3.
To know yourself, see how others do, to know others look into your own heart.
Smiles, Sydney

4.
Every animal knows more than you do.
Proverb, Native American

5.
Sin, guilt, neurosis --they are one and the same, the fruit of the tree of knowledge.
Miller, Henry

6.
Knowledge has to be improved, challenged, and increased constantly, or it vanishes.
Drucker, Peter F.

7.
Man is not weak; knowledge is more than equivalent to force.
Johnson, Samuel

8.
Knowledge is the only elegance.
Emerson, Ralph Waldo

9.
You have to believe in God before you can say there are things that man was not meant to know. I don't think there's anything man wasn't meant to know. There are just some stupid things that people shouldn't do.
Cronenberg, David

10.
It is, I fear, but a vain show of fulfilling the heathen precept, Know thyself, and too often leads to a self-estimate which will subsist in the absence of that fruit by which alone the quality of the tree is made evident.
Eliot, George

11.
And all your future lies beneath your hat.
Oldham, John

12.
One secures the gold of the spirit when he finds himself.
Bristol, Claude M.

13.
A knowledge of men is the prime secret of business success.
Mills, Darius Ogden

14.
Proclaim not all thou knowest, all thou knowest, all thou hast, nor all thou cans't.
Franklin, Benjamin

15.
He who knows little quickly tells it.
Proverb, Italian

16.
There is a period of life when we swallow knowledge of ourselves and it becomes either good or sour inside.
Bailey, Pearl

17.
One thing only I know, and that is that I know nothing.
Socrates

18.
I think knowing what you cannot do is more important than knowing what you can.
Ball, Lucille

19.
We forge gradually our greatest instrument for understanding the world -- introspection. We discover that humanity may resemble us very considerably -- that the best way of knowing the inwardness of our neighbors is to know ourselves.
Lippmann, Walter

20.
Knowledge is a polite word for dead but not buried imagination.
Cummings, E.E. (Edward. E.)

21.
Some people drink deeply from the fountain of knowledge. Others just gargle.
Bright, Grant M.

22.
No man knows less than the man who knows it all

23.
All men by nature desire knowledge.
Aristotle

24.
It is impossible to begin to learn that which one thinks one already knows.
Epictetus

25.
How do you know so much about everything? was asked of a very wise and intelligent man; and the answer was By never being afraid or ashamed to ask questions as to anything of which I was ignorant.
Abbott, John

26.
I honestly believe it is better to know nothing than to know what ain't so.
Billings, Josh

27.
Know-how will surpass guess-how.

28.
You can live a lifetime and at the end, know more about other people than you know about yourself.
Markham, Beryl

29.
We are drowning in information and starving for knowledge.
Roger, Rutherford D.

30.
To know the right means of getting something done is virtually to have done it.
Caine, Mark

31.
Since we can't know what knowledge will be most needed in the future, it is senseless to try to teach it in advance. Instead, we should try to turn out people who love learning so much and learn so well that they will be able to learn whatever needs to be learned.
Holt, John

32.
Knowledge is a process of piling up facts; wisdom lies in their simplification.
Fischer, Martin H.

33.
Those who think they know it all are very annoying to those of us who do.
Mueller, Robert K.

34.
The most excellent and divine counsel, the best and most profitable advertisement of all others, but the least practiced, is to study and learn how to know ourselves. This is the foundation of wisdom and the highway to whatever is good. God, Nature, the wise, the world, preach man, exhort him both by word and deed to the study of himself.
Charron, Pierre

35.
You can always draw as well as you know how to. I flatter myself that I feel more than I express on canvas; but I know that is not so.
Hunt, William Morris

36.
God grant that not only the love of liberty but a thorough knowledge of the rights of man may pervade all the nations of the earth, so that a philosopher may set his foot anywhere on its surface and say: This is my country!
Franklin, Benjamin

37.
Knowledge is power. Rather, knowledge is happiness, because to have knowledge -- broad, deep knowledge -- is to know true ends from false, and lofty things from low. To know the thoughts and deeds that have marked man's progress is to feel the great heartthrobs of humanity through the centuries; and if one does not feel in these pulsations a heavenward striving, one must indeed be deaf to the harmonies of life.
Keller, Helen

38.
It is better of course to know useless things than to know nothing.
Stoppard, Tom

39.
It is nothing for one to know something unless another knows you know it.
Proverb, Persian

40.
The degree of one's emotions varies inversely with one's knowledge of the facts- the less you know the hotter you get.
Russell, Bertrand

41.
To know is to know that you know nothing. That is the meaning of true knowledge.
Confucius

42.
Knowledge and human power are synonymous.
Bacon, Francis

43.
Knowledge is of two kinds: We know a subject ourselves, or we know where we can find information about it.
Johnson, Samuel

44.
To learn to get along without, to realize that what the world is going to demand of us may be a good deal more important than what we are entitled to demand of it -- this is a hard lesson.
Catton, Bruce

45.
When you cease to strive to understand, then you will know without understanding.
Proverb, Chinese

46.
There is, so I believe, in the essence of everything, something that we cannot call learning. There is, my friend, only a knowledge -- that is everywhere.
Hesse, Hermann

47.
The knowledge of God is far from the love of Him.
Miller, Keith

48.
A superficial knowledge is not enough. It must be a knowledge capable of analyzing a situation quickly and making an immediate decision.
Robert, Cavett

49.
If you have knowledge, let others light their candles with it.
Churchill, Winston

50.
A man of knowledge lives by acting, not by thinking about acting.
Castaneda, Carlos
